Blitz.js logo

Blitz.js

Provides typesafe data access and authentication for React applications built with Next.js.

Made by randon Bayer and Blitz.js Contributors

  • Developer Tools

  • next-js

  • react-framework

  • JavaScript Framework

  • react-ui-toolkit

What is Blitz.js?

Blitz is a comprehensive, full-stack framework built on Next.js, designed to streamline the development and scaling of React-based applications. It aims to provide a cohesive and opinionated approach to building monolithic, production-ready web applications, while maintaining flexibility for developers to customize and extend the framework as needed

Highlights

  • Typesafe API Layer: Blitz simplifies the process of building and interacting with APIs, allowing developers to read and write data from the client with full type safety, without the hassle of managing HTTP or serialization
  • Authentication: Blitz offers a powerful and flexible authentication system, with support for various third-party integrations like Google, GitHub, and Auth0, granting developers more control with simpler APIs
  • Conventions and Codegen: Blitz sets up a new application in a matter of minutes, providing a pre-configured environment with features such as user authentication, sign-up, and forgot password functionality, as well as a choice of form libraries
  • All-in-One Solution: Blitz supports the management of the entire application stack, from the database to the frontend, within a single codebase, allowing for streamlined development and deployment.

Platforms

  • Web
  • Self-Hosted

Languages

  • English

Social

Features

    • React